Understanding the Canadian Online Gaming Landscape
The Canadian online gaming market is characterized by a unique blend of provincial control and private sector participation. Unlike some countries with nationwide regulations, Canada’s approach is decentralized. The Western provinces, such as British Columbia, and Ontario have embraced a more open model, allowing private operators to obtain licenses and compete with provincially-run sites. This fosters innovation and provides players with a wider selection of games and services. However, other provinces maintain a more restrictive stance, limiting access to government-operated platforms. This disparity creates challenges for both players seeking diverse options and operators aiming for nationwide reach. The regulatory landscape is constantly shifting, with ongoing discussions about potential harmonization and modernization. The Role of Provincial Regulations
Provincial regulations exert a significant influence on the types of games available, the licensing requirements for operators, and the measures taken to protect players. For instance, in Ontario with its iGaming Ontario regime, operators must adhere to strict standards of responsible gambling, security, and fairness. These regulations, while beneficial for consumer protection, can also present barriers to entry for smaller operators. Compliance costs can be substantial, and the licensing process can be lengthy and complex. However, obtaining a license from a reputable provincial authority is a strong indicator of an operator’s commitment to providing a safe and trustworthy gaming environment. Understanding these dynamics is vital for Canadian players making informed decisions about where to play.
| Province | Online Gaming Model | Key Regulations |
|---|---|---|
| Ontario | Open Market (Licensed Private Operators) | iGaming Ontario, focus on responsible gambling |
| British Columbia | Hybrid (Provincial & Licensed Private) | PlayNow BC, stringent licensing |
| Quebec | Provincial Monopoly (Loto-Québec) | Espacejeux, government-controlled operations |
| Alberta | Provincial Monopoly (Alberta Gaming, Liquor and Cannabis) | PlayAlberta, limited private participation |
The table above illustrates the diversity of approaches across Canada, highlighting the need for players to be aware of the specific regulations governing online gaming in their province. This understanding empowers them to make informed choices and to ensure they are playing on legal and reputable platforms.

Bonus Offers and Wagering Requirements
Bonus offers are a major draw for many online casino players. The-lab-casinoca.ca, like its competitors, likely offers a range of bonuses, including welcome bonuses for new players, deposit bonuses, and free spins. However, it’s crucial to carefully examine the associated wagering requirements before claiming any bonus. Wagering requirements dictate how many times a player must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ount as well) before being able to withdraw any winnings. Higher wagering requirements can make it difficult to convert a bonus into actual cash. Comparing the bonus offers and wagering requirements of the-lab-casinoca.ca with those of its competitors is vital for maximizing value and minimizing frustration. Pay attention to any restrictions on which games contribute to the wagering requirements – some games may contribute less than others.

The Importance of Responsible Gambling
Regardless of the platform chosen, responsible gambling should always be a top priority. Online casinos can be entertaining, but it’s important to approach them with moderation and awareness. Setting limits on deposits and wagers, avoiding chasing losses, and taking regular breaks are all essential practices. The-lab-casinoca.ca, as a responsible operator, should provide tools and resources to help players manage their gambling behavior,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to problem gambling support organizations. Players should be aware of the signs of problem gambling – such as spending more than intended, lying about gambling habits, or experiencing negative consequences as a result of gambling – and seek help if needed. Remember, g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.
